Hi ,

I need some help with php version , is there any way i can update it to latest version ? Is there any command that does that?
When i login on phpmyadmin it says --> A newer version of phpMyAdmin is available and you should consider upgrading. The newest version is 4.4.15.2, released on 2015-12-25.

Also

Configuration of pmadb… not OK
General relation features Disabled

Thank you

You can install the latest phpmyadmin version for ubuntu/debian if you use the repository from nijel: https://www.dev-metal.com/installsetup- ... -pangolin/

<code>
sudo add-apt-repository ppa:nijel/phpmyadmin
sudo apt-get update
apt-get install phpmyadmin
</code>

Also possible on other os versions.

Hi , sorry for late replay. I would like to thanks for your answer but im using Centos 7 (64-bit version) .

sudo add-apt-repository ppa:nijel/phpmyadmin
sudo: add-apt-repository: command not found

Give this a try,

Code: Select all

  yum --enablerepo=remi update phpMyAdmin
